Auto Panel Reset<br />

8-39<br />

Default Setting (System Menu)<br />

If no jobs are run for a certain period of time, automatically reset settings and return to the default setting.<br />

NOTE: Refer to page 8-43 for the default settings.<br />

• Auto Panel Reset ON/OFF<br />

Select to use Auto Panel Reset or not.<br />

Use the procedure below to specify the auto panel reset setting. The default setting is On.<br />
